Israel argues that Hamas could have ended the suffering of Gaza's 2 million people by disarming and renouncing violence.

For a second Friday, thousands of protesters gathered at five sites along the 65km-long (40-mile) Israel-Gaza border. "The circumstances in which journalists were hit, allegedly by IDF fire, are unknown to us and are being examined".

Israel said there were also attempts to lob rudimentary explosives and damage or penetrate the border fence, as well as a pair of militants who shot at soldiers.

The report further referred to concerns by the Israeli army sources that in case of many Palestinian casualties, the global community might renew diplomatic pressure on the regime.

Many demonstrators stayed far back from the border fence, picnicking in the barley fields and holding a tent camp sit-in, but some young Palestinians burned tires and threw rocks toward the fence.

A Human Rights Watch report alleged that the IDF used "lethal force outside of life-threatening situations in violation of worldwide norms", and accused the Israeli government of giving orders that all but guarenteed casualties. On Thursday, President Donald Trump's Middle East peace envoy Jason Greenblatt condemned Palestinian leaders "who call for violence or who send protesters-including children-to the fence, knowing that they may be injured or killed".

The "March of Return" is set to climax on May 15, when Israel will mark 70 years of independence - a day Palestinians mark as the "nakba" ("catastrophe" in Arabic) - and the United States will cut the ribbon on its controversial new embassy in Jerusalem.
